1834 Bust Half, MS64+
O-109, Small Date, Small Letters
1834 50C Small Date, Small Letters, O-109, R.1, MS64+ PCGS.
Star 10 is repunched, the primary identifier for Overton-109.
Dynamic luster and an unmarked appearance confirm the quality of
the present near-Gem. The medium steel-gray and golden-brown
surfaces are nicely struck except for the stars. Not a rare
variety, but desirable in the present exceptional condition.
Population (all Small Date, Small Letters varieties combined): 75
in 64 (5 in 64+), 19 finer (10/17).Coin Index Numbers: (NGC ID# 24FY, Variety PCGS# 39913, Base PCGS# 6166, Greysheet# 194422)
Weight: 13.48 grams
Metal: 89.24% Silver, 10.76% Copper
